寄存器最后一位
答:贾府中秋开夜宴,贾母邀大家一起到凸碧山庄赏月,众人击鼓吃酒。黛玉见贾府中许多人赏月,贾母犹叹人少,不似当年热闹,不觉对景感怀。湘云过来陪她,二人来到凹晶溪馆联诗,湘云联寒塘渡鹤影,黛玉对冷月葬诗魂,湘云赞黛玉诗句新奇,妙玉听见亦夸赞,将刚二人的诗誊写出来并结了尾。
答:使用递加寄存器就可以了,一个脉冲按键触发递加寄存器,每按键一次,寄存器自加1,所以寄存器最后一位就会在0和1之间变化,用寄存器的最后一位触发输出端即可。
答:你只用判断这个寄存器的最后一位不就行了,比如VW100这个寄存器,你判断v100.0=1则为奇数,v100.0=0则VW100寄存器的数为偶数
答:寄存器的“位”是寄存器的最小存储单元,它可以保存一个“0”和者“1”这两种状态数据的其中之一,也就是一位二进制数据,16位寄存器就是有16个这样的寄存器所组成的一个二进制数据,用来代表更多的数据符号和功能,如下图就是一个16位寄存器的存储示意:...
答:UxCTL寄存器是一个8位的寄存器。UASRT模块的基本操作由该寄存器的控制位确定的,它包含了通信协议、通信模式和校验位等的选择。图给出了寄存器的各个位。图UxCTL寄存器由图可以看出,UxCTL寄存器主要包括8个有效的控制位。为了增加对UxCTL寄存器的了解,知道怎样对该寄存器进行正确的设置,下面对UxCTL寄存器的各个位进行详...
答:1、寄存器 32位寄存器有16个,分别是: 4个数据寄存器(EAX、EBX、ECX、EDX)。 2个变址和指针寄存器(ESI和EDI);2个指针寄存器(ESP和EBP)。 6个段寄存器(ES、CS、SS、DS、FS、GS)。 1个指令指针寄存器(EIP);1个标志寄存器(EFlags)。 2、数据寄存器 数据寄存器主要用来保存操作数和运算结果等信息,从而节省读取...
答:不是全部的都要清零,比如你只需要对寄存器的一位进行位运算时候,直接&=0或者|=1就进行赋值了,不管原来这一位是什么都无所谓,当你要寄存器的多个位赋值时候,你要想一次赋值一位,一条代码赋值一位,也可以。一次赋值多个位时候,因为赋值0和1的运算法则不一样,不先置0,原来的状态会影响你的...
答:是。P1是一个8位的寄存器。P1寄存器的8个位名称分别是:P1.7、P1.6、P1.5、P1.4、P1.3、P1.2、P1.1、P1.0上面的0X开头的数,是以4个“位”为一个单位进制。
答:就是暂时还没有对这些位定义的 有可能你看比同系列更高级点单片机就有可能对这些位做出定义。而保留这些位的目的是为了使一系列的单片机代码可以兼容。也就是相同的寄存器功能是一样的,如果是没存在这样的功能 那么保留寄存器的初始化将是没有效果的。大致意思是这样。
答:1. 在单片机编程中,SFR(Special Function Register,特殊功能寄存器)用于控制和访问单片机内部硬件资源。2. "8位"指的是这些寄存器的数据宽度为8位,即能够存储0到255的十进制数。3. 在8位单片机中,所有寄存器如累加器(ACC)、状态寄存器(PSW)、地址寄存器等都是8位的。4. 每个8位寄存器可以...
网友评论:
延类13557655612:
什么是移位寄存器 -
14624夔居
:[答案] 工作步骤与工作进度: 从逻辑结构上看,移位寄存器有以下两个显著特征:(1)移位寄存器是由相同的寄存单元所组成.... 串行输出就是在时钟脉冲作用下,寄存器最后一位输出端依次一位一位地输出寄存器的数据;并行输出则是寄存器的每个寄...
延类13557655612:
80C51单片机的psw寄存器各位标志的意义如何? -
14624夔居
: Cy(PSW.7)进位标志位;Ac(PSW.6)辅助进位标志位;F0(PSW.5)用户自定义标志位;RS1,RS0(PSW.4,PSW.3)4组工作寄存器选择控制位;OV(PSW.2)溢出标志位;PSW.1保留位,未用;P(PSW.0)奇偶标志位
延类13557655612:
欧姆龙什么是带进位加法运算?什么是双字带进位或不带进位加法运算?还有带符号不带符号有什么区别? -
14624夔居
: 欧姆龙的话表示的就是2个寄存器,不带进位加法会把最后一位的值改变带符号数就是用寄存器的最后一位表示正负(1为负,0为正),带进位的加法会保留最后一位的状态,双字就是32位数,导致正负发生变化.不带符号的数表示的就是正数,运算时需要选择带进位加法
延类13557655612:
移位寄存器的简介 -
14624夔居
: 在数字电路中,用来存放二进制数据或代码的电路称为寄存器.寄存器是由具有存储功能的触发器组合起来构成的.一个触发器可以存储一位二进制代码,存放N位二进制代码的寄存器,需用n个触发器来构成.按功能可分为:基本寄存器和移位寄存器. 移位寄存器中的数据可以在移位脉冲作用下依次逐位右移或左移,数据既可以并行输入、并行输出,也可以串行输入、串行输出,还可以并行输入、串行输出,串行输入、并行输出,十分灵活,用途也很广.
延类13557655612:
新手问个寄存器设置的问题,我理解的对否? -
14624夔居
: 楼主绝大多数地方理解是正确的.1. 寄存器在设置的时候一般有两种,一种是按位设置的,就是单独给某个位进行设置,就用.bit.一种是一下子给寄存器的位都设置了,每个位都赋值,这样就用.all.2.很多一个功能位并不是只有1个位来组成的,有时候是由2位,3位甚至4位来组成一个功能位,这样,这个位的取值就不止0和1,可能是0-3,0-7.这个楼主可以查看一下寄存器的说明就知道了,这里的bit并不是指一个物理上的位,而是指一个功能位.
延类13557655612:
关于单片机工作寄存器位 地址 字节的理解 -
14624夔居
: 不知道你问的是什么问题!可能你根本就没理解寄存器地址的基本概念!51单片机因为是8位机,其每一个寄存器的位数也是8位的,也就是一个字节的长度.32位机的寄存器是32位的,也就是一个字的长度.每一个寄存器对应的独立的物理地址(就像一栋楼房里面,每一个房间都有唯一的门牌号一样.而每间有八张床,床上有人就为1,没人就为0).而你说的00H-1FH就是这32间房的门牌号的范围.因为还有其他的房间(寄存器).
延类13557655612:
循环移位寄存器与移位寄存器有什么区别 -
14624夔居
: 移位寄存器一般是用于串并转换或bit序列搜索.初始化的原则就是里面的初始值对系统应用不产生误动作就行.
延类13557655612:
移位寄存器是干嘛的? -
14624夔居
: 移位功能就是在移位脉冲作用下,存储在集萃器中的数据能逐位向左或向右的功能.可以用来寄存数码,实现数据的串行-并行的转换、数值的运算及数据处理等.
延类13557655612:
台达PLC DVP20EX00R2 模拟量读入命令?比如FROM K0 K6 D0 K1. -
14624夔居
: from k0 k6 d0 k1是指编号为0(k0)的(第一个特殊功能块)模块的缓冲寄存器(bfm)号为6(k6)开始的1(k1)个数据读入基本单元,并存于从[d.]开始的1(k1)个数据寄存器中. dvp04ad是台达的模拟量输入扩展块..模拟量转数字量(a/d)
延类13557655612:
一个计算机的操作系统是32位的,它的寄存器是多少位的? -
14624夔居
: 寄存器与操作系统无关.寄存器是硬件,固定的,比如是64位的,但安装的操作系统可以是32或64的.